package xio_test
import (
"bytes"
"io"
"math/rand"
"sync"
"testing"
"time"
"github.com/ozanh/xio"
)
func BenchmarkCompareReadersDataWithBuffer(b *testing.B) {
seed := time.Now().UnixNano()
leftData, err := io.ReadAll(
io.LimitReader(rand.New(rand.NewSource(seed)), 1000*1000),
)
if err != nil {
b.Fatal(err)
}
rightData, err := io.ReadAll(
io.LimitReader(rand.New(rand.NewSource(seed)), 1000*1000),
)
if err != nil {
b.Fatal(err)
}
left := bytes.NewReader(leftData)
right := bytes.NewReader(rightData)
buf := make([]byte, 8*64*bytes.MinRead)
b.ResetTimer()
b.ReportAllocs()
for i := 0; i < b.N; i++ {
err := xio.CompareReadersDataWithBuffer(left, right, buf)
if err != nil {
b.Fatal(err)
}
left.Reset(leftData)
right.Reset(rightData)
}
}
func BenchmarkBufPipe_with_StorageBuffer(b *testing.B) {
const payloadSize = 10 * 1024 * 1024
const blockSize = 1 * 1024 * 1024
const storageSize = payloadSize
// Allocate all the memory we need before the benchmark starts.
bsb := xio.NewStorageBuffer(make([]byte, storageSize), false)
payload := make([]byte, payloadSize)
reader := bytes.NewReader(payload)
copyBufr := make([]byte, 32*1024)
b.ResetTimer()
b.ReportAllocs()
for i := 0; i < b.N; i++ {
reader.Reset(payload)
pr, pw := xio.BufPipe(blockSize, storageSize, bsb)
var wg sync.WaitGroup
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
n, err := reader.WriteTo(pw)
_ = pw.CloseWithError(err)
if err != nil {
b.Error(err)
}
if n != payloadSize {
b.Errorf("unexpected write size, got: %d", n)
}
}()
n, err := io.CopyBuffer(io.Discard, pr, copyBufr)
_ = pr.CloseWithError(err)
if err != nil {
b.Fatal(err)
}
if n != payloadSize {
b.Fatalf("unexpected read size, got: %d", n)
}
wg.Wait()
}
}
func BenchmarkIoPipe(b *testing.B) {
const payloadSize = 10 * 1024 * 1024
payload := make([]byte, payloadSize)
reader := bytes.NewReader(payload)
copyBufr := make([]byte, 32*1024)
b.ResetTimer()
b.ReportAllocs()
for i := 0; i < b.N; i++ {
reader.Reset(payload)
pr, pw := io.Pipe()
var wg sync.WaitGroup
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
n, err := reader.WriteTo(pw)
_ = pw.CloseWithError(err)
if err != nil {
b.Error(err)
}
if n != payloadSize {
b.Errorf("unexpected write size, got: %d", n)
}
}()
n, err := io.CopyBuffer(io.Discard, pr, copyBufr)
_ = pr.CloseWithError(err)
if err != nil {
b.Fatal(err)
}
if n != payloadSize {
b.Fatalf("unexpected read size, got: %d", n)
}
wg.Wait()
}
}
